Milkman... I think all of us are just making up the rules as we go?...including the so called authorities
...I think many of us are basing our interpretations of the legislation (or lack thereof) on what we feel to be morally correct... but without any clear and difinitive legislation to go by.....because lets face it ...the legislation is seriously lagging behind the technology...until the legislators address the current issues the confusion will remain.

Make no mistake....if we... as a body ...continue to rock the boat and stir the legislators into action...we WILL end up paying far more by the the way of licences and fees than we do now.

From my point of view and understanding ..its all fairly simple...you are entitled to copy your own CDs as many times as you like and keep them at home...however you are only allowed to play those in public for which you have paid a yearly format shift licence...in other words if an operator copies a disc 10 times and plays it in 10 venues on 10 different rigs then he should pay the licence fee x10...there should not be any argument or confusion over that surely?

The Crunch comes for downloads ....are they legal...I think so....are you legally allowed to play them in public...I suspect you are ...but I have not seen any reference to this in any legislation anywhere...are you allowed to copy one download across 10 rigs?...morally you would have to say No....but I have NOT seen any reference to that issue anywhere so what and who is going to stop you?...its absurd to think that the Karaoke Police will come a knockin on your door to check your rigs and computers considering current outdated legislation.....If of course I started selling my newly copied 8000 songs for say $8000 to establishing Karaoke operators...I would be making some serious money and more than likely would come to the notice of the copyright police

Personally I think that we hosts will be better served by not becoming too pedantic about the whole issue...NOT spend too much time worrying about what other hosts have done or are doing...and just get on with it....Let sleeping dogs lay...or else pay considerably more for fees and licences than we do now...
